Land reform, or agrarian reform, involves the changing of laws and regulations regarding land ownership. Most arguments for agrarian reform focus on its social and economic benefits while arguments against it focus on the possibility of the reforms resulting in the disadvantage or victimization of certain people.

Sociology is a science give arguments for and against it?

For: Sociology uses systematic research methods to study human behavior and social interactions, allowing for empirical evidence to support its theories. It follows the scientific method by formulating hypotheses, collecting data, and testing theories. Against: Sociology deals with social phenomena that are difficult to measure objectively, leading to challenges in replicating studies and establishing causality. The subjectivity and biases of researchers and participants can also influence results, making the findings less reliable than those of natural sciences.


Samuel Cornish for or against slavery?

Samuel Cornish was against slavery. He was a prominent African American abolitionist and journalist who co-founded the first African American newspaper in the United States, The Freedom's Journal, which advocated for the abolition of slavery and civil rights for African Americans. His writings and activism played a significant role in the fight against slavery.
